| | Potential Medical Cause | Action for Vet/Owner | |-----------------------|----------------------------|--------------------------| | Sudden aggression in a friendly dog | Pain (dental disease, osteoarthritis), hypothyroidism, brain tumor | Full oral exam, joint palpation, thyroid panel | | House-soiling in a trained cat | Lower urinary tract disease (FLUTD), chronic kidney disease, diabetes | Urinalysis, bloodwork, abdominal ultrasound | | Night-time vocalization in an elderly pet | Canine cognitive dysfunction (dementia), hypertension, vision/hearing loss | Cognitive assessment, blood pressure check, neurologic exam | | Pacing/restlessness in a horse | Gastric ulcers, lameness, neurologic disease (Equine Herpesvirus-1) | Gastroscopy, flexion tests, neurologic evaluation |

Animal behavior and veterinary science are deeply interconnected fields that bridge the gap between understanding how animals interact with their environment and how to maintain their physical and mental health. While focuses on the evolutionary and ecological origins of behavior , veterinary behavioral medicine applies these principles to clinical practice to diagnose and treat psychological and behavioral disorders in animals .
